Engagement Metrics

Engagement can be categorized into several dimensions, each essential in its context:

1. User Interaction: Within the digital realm, user interaction denotes the significant exchanges occurring between individuals and online platforms. This encompasses actions such as ‘likes’, ‘shares’, ‘comments’, and the duration of a visit to a website. Elevated user interaction frequently signals that the material is connecting effectively with its audience. As per HubSpot, businesses demonstrating strong user interaction commonly experience a 20% boost in their revenue.

2. **Workforce Involvement**: Within the professional environment, fostering involvement is vital for both output and team spirit. A truly involved team member is emotionally connected and dedicated to their duties and the company’s objectives. Research by Gallup indicates that businesses boasting high levels of staff involvement achieve 21% greater profitability compared to those with lower engagement.

3. **Community Involvement**: Community involvement pertains to participation within groups and networks, frequently assessed through actions such as volunteering or civic participation. Elevated levels of community involvement are associated with enhanced mental well-being and overall community health.

Measurement and Instruments

Measuring user interaction requires a range of instruments and indicators, which vary based on the specific situation. When dealing with digital platforms, applications such as Google Analytics provide valuable data on user involvement by monitoring statistics like bounce rate, how long sessions last, and the number of pages viewed per session. To assess employee commitment, companies often utilize questionnaires and feedback mechanisms, including the Gallup Q12 or the Employee Net Promoter Score (eNPS).

In social contexts, engagement can be more qualitative, assessed through community feedback and participation rates in events or initiatives.
